Hello! If your sister can’t find the way hoe to deal with such behavior it would be good to seek a support of a specialist. It doesn’t mean a child needs a therapy. It means your sister can get some good and practical advices which will improve his son’s behavior. I used to ignore the unwanted behavior of my children and it worked in most cases. But, there are situations when unwanted behavior can’t be ignored and then I used the time-out method. When the unacceptable behavior occurred I used to tell my children that such behavior is unacceptable and gave them a warning that I would put them in time-out area which was usually a corner or a chair. I was always calm and didn’t look angry. I never discussed their behavior and always looked for ways to reward them for their good behavior later on.
